On behalf of the Organizing Committee of APASL STC Islamabad 2019, it is my great pleasure to welcome all the participants across the country and from abroad to attend the esteemed Conference on Viral Hepatitis from December 5-8, 2019 at Serena Hotel Islamabad, Pakistan. The theme of the meeting is Elimination of Viral Hepatitis by 2030 “From Dream to Reality”.

It is indeed an honor that PSSLD will be holding Third APASL Single Topic Conference this year. PSSLD is working with clear objective to create awareness among health care workers and to sensitize them to the burden of Liver diseases and its implications in the community.

The meeting’s content and activities are tailored to a wide audience of Hepatologists, Gastroenterologists, General practitioners and Postgraduate students. In this meeting we have included several interactive sessions with live audience response. Scientific program has CME credits and offers fantastic updates for consultants, trainees and primary care physicians. Faculty will include international key opinion leaders, mainly from the Asia Pacific region as well as from home.
